Ski Trails

Picture of cross country skiers breaking trail through the snow.

Alaska is known for its long, beautiful winters and excellent opportunities for skiing enthusiasts.

While most BLM-managed trails allow motorized activities, some trails are managed for non-motorized activities. 

The BLM Campbell Tract in Anchorage offers groomed non-motorized cross-country ski trails. Each winter the popular Tour of Anchorage cross country ski marathon crosses the Campbell Tract trail system to connect seamlessly with Municipality of Anchorage ski trails.

The White Mountains National Recreation Area offers the groomed, non-motorized 5-mile Ski Loop Trail. The White Mountains area includes almost one million acres of public lands with more than 200 miles of multiple use trails for winter enthusiasts to explore.
